  • Patent number: 11573169
    Abstract: A method of conducting a shear strength test on a semiconductor element with improved pressing force direction includes pressing a peripheral surface of the semiconductor element with a shear tool in a direction inclined to gradually head away from the surface of the substrate along the direction of pressing to conduct a shear strength test with a die shear strength tester.

  • Patent number: 9417799
    Abstract: A memory system includes a nonvolatile semiconductor memory having blocks, the block being data erasing unit; and a controller configured to execute; an update processing for; writing superseding data in a block, the superseding data being treated as valid data; and invalidating superseded data having the same logical address as the superseding data, the superseded data being treated as invalid data; and a compaction processing for; retrieving blocks having invalid data using a management table, the management table managing blocks in a linked list format for each number of valid data included in the block; selecting a compaction source block having at least one valid data from the retrieved blocks; copying a plurality of valid data included in the compaction source blocks into a compaction target block; invalidating the plurality of valid data in the compaction source blocks; and releasing the compaction source blocks in which all data are invalidated.

  • Patent number: 9118829
    Abstract: An imaging device is provided that includes an imaging component, an image processor a display component, and a controller. The imaging component is configured to capture a subject image and produce image information that corresponds to the subject image. The image information has a first region and a second region. The image processor is configured to perform a vignette processing on the second region to produce a vignetted image. The image processor is further configured to enlarge at least part of the first region to produce an enlarged image according to an operation signal from an interface component. The display component is configured to display the vignetted image on the second region and the enlarged image on the first region. The controller is configured to control at least one of the imaging component, the image processor, and the display component.
